White Bean Noodle Soup
Hearty & healthy soup packed with savory vegetables
19 ingredients
•Prep: 10 mins•Cook: 20 mins
Matt Santos•Apr 25, 2024
This hearty and healthy soup is packed with savory vegetables and balanced with refreshing flavors. It’s a great recipe for a quick and easy dinner when you’re craving something warm and filling. Enjoy!
Family medicine resident and home cook 🩺 🔪 Sharing my passion for food and wellness to educate, entertain, and inspire 🥘 🌿
Instructions
Heat a large pot or Dutch oven on medium heat and add 3 tbs olive oil.
Sauté onion (1 medium), celery (4 ribs), and carrot (2 medium) until softened.
Add salt and pepper (to taste), thyme (½ tsp), rosemary (4 cloves), garlic, optional chili flakes (½ tsp), and sun-dried tomatoes (2 Tbsp); mix well.
Add balsamic vinegar (2 Tbsp), white beans (2 15 oz cans), and bay leaves (2); mix well.
Add vegetable stock (8 cups) and optional bouillon (1 Tbsp).
Bring to a boil and add in pasta shells (2 cups); mix well.
Stir occasionally until pasta is fully cooked. Taste stock and add salt and pepper (to taste) if needed.
Turn off the heat and mix in spinach (3 cups).
Garnish with olive oil, lemon juice, and parsley. Enjoy!